Effect of instructions on elementary cognitive tasks sensitive to individual differences.

D K Detterman1, C G Andrist

  • 1Case Western Reserve University.

The American Journal of Psychology
|January 1, 1990
PubMed
Summary

Cognitive task performance is significantly influenced by instructions. Different instruction types (written, non-verbal, none) affect task outcomes and general intelligence correlations, especially in complex cognitive tasks.

Area of Science:

  • Cognitive Psychology
  • Experimental Psychology

Background:

  • Understanding how external factors influence cognitive performance is crucial.
  • Basic cognitive tasks are fundamental for assessing cognitive abilities.

Purpose of the Study:

  • To investigate the impact of different types of instructions on basic cognitive tasks.
  • To examine how instructions affect both mean performance and individual differences.

Main Methods:

  • Two studies were conducted with college students and military recruits.
  • Participants completed tasks like choice reaction time, match-to-sample, tachistoscopic threshold, and probed recall.
  • Conditions included written, non-verbal, or no instructions.

Main Results:

  • Instruction type significantly altered mean performance across tasks.
  • Correlations between task parameters and general intelligence varied with instructional conditions.
  • Group differences diminished with practice, and individual differences were more affected in complex tasks.
  • Conclusions:

    • Instructions play a significant role in shaping performance on basic cognitive tasks.
    • The effect of instructions on individual differences is less pronounced than on mean performance.
